How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    SEN Teacher -Basildon

    Education and training | Mainstream Primary School | September 2026 Start

    A highly regarded and well-resourced Primary School in Basildon is seeking a dedicated and nurturing SEN Teacher to join their exceptional team, within their Autism Provision. This is a full-time long-term position, available to start from September 2026.

    The provision supports children and young people with ASD, with the aim of integrating them back into mainstream education. Every pupil is unique, and the school prides itself on offering a holistic, child-centred approach that includes a multi-disciplinary team, specialist equipment, and purpose-built facilities.

    As an SEN Teacher, you will play a pivotal role in delivering meaningful and creative learning experiences, with a strong emphasis on communication, sensory engagement, and life skills. You will be supported by a team of experienced support staff and benefit from excellent training, CPD and career development opportunities.

    JOB OVERVIEW - SEN Teacher (PMLD Focus)

    Full-time, long-term position
    September 2026 start
    MPS1 - MPS6 + SEN Allowance
    Located in Basildon, Essex
    Small class sizes with high levels of support
    Emphasis on sensory curriculum and personalised learning
    Multi-agency working with therapists and medical staff Education and training

    PERSON SPECIFICATION - SEN Teacher

    UK Qualified Teacher Status (QTS or equivalent) is essential
    Experience teaching pupils with ASD or complex needs preferred
    Confident using alternative communication methods (e.g., PECS, Makaton, AAC)
    Patient, resilient, and genuinely passionate about SEN education
    Able to work collaboratively with LSAs, therapists, and families
    Open to ECTs with SEN placement experience and a genuine interest in PMLD

    SCHOOL DETAILS -Mainstream School in Basildon with ASD Provision

    'Outstanding' leadership and supportive staff culture
    Ongoing CPD and clear progression opportunities
    On-site parking and accessible by public transport
